<p>Broadway impresario J. Lester Wallack-who would go on to serve seven terms as Shepherd-gave Montague a space in his family plot in <a href="page.php?w=Green-Wood_Cemetery">Green-Wood Cemetery</a>; the two rest next to each other today.</p>

<p>In April 1880 The Lambs moved to 34 West 26th Street, the first time under "a roof controlled by the Club." It would be the Clubhouse for 12 years.
